"Sandwichman & Mana Ashida's Hakase-chan " (TV Asahi) is a show in which children with knowledge and talents that rival those of adults give funny lessons as " Hakase-chan " (teacher). The show will air from 6:30 pm to 8:54 pm on May 3rd and will explore the seven great mysteries of Mount Takao, a popular mountain in Hachioji, Tokyo, which is easily accessible from the city center.

As they climb Mt. Takao, the show's familiar face "Temple and Shrine Hakase-chan," Maruyama Yuka (11 years old, 6th grade), and comedian Tsukaji Muga from the comedy duo "Drunk Dragon," approach the mystery. The first mystery the two encounter is "A soba restaurant penetrated by a divine tree." At the foot of Mt. Takao, a long-established soba restaurant founded in the Edo period, a persimmon tree about 150 years old penetrates the building. Even when the restaurant was expanded, the tree was not cut down, but was protected by allowing the ceiling to penetrate. What is the reason for taking such good care of the persimmon tree?

Joshinmon Gate stands at the entrance to Yakuo-in Temple, which stands on the mountainside. Even though Yakuo-in is a Buddhist temple, Joshinmon Gate is shaped like a torii gate, which is the symbol of Shinto shrines. Why is that? In addition, the mysteries of the "cedar tree that moves by itself" and the "mysterious tower that brings 100 times the good fortune" will be unravelled.

In the studio, MC Mana Ashida takes on the challenge of the mountain priest's training, which is still practiced today. In order to experience the "silent act" of not saying a word, if she can endure interference for 30 seconds and maintain no reaction, she will succeed. She goes into full actor mode, but falls into a trap set by Mikio Date.

Actors Michiko Hada and Gaku Hamada will appear as guests in the studio.
